What is Stuart Broad famous for?

He is England’s second highest wicket taker in Test cricket. On the morning of the fifth and final day of the third Test of the 2020 series against the West Indies, Broad became the seventh bowler to take 500 wickets in Test cricket, after dismissing Kraigg Brathwaite.

What happened to Anderson and Broad?

Broad, Anderson axed as England dump EIGHT stars after Ashes disaster. England have dropped James Anderson and Stuart Broad, the country’s two all-time leading Test wicket-takers, for their tour of the West Indies as part of a major shake-up of the troubled team.

Where are the Broads in England?

The Broads, also called Norfolk Broads, system of inland waterways in the administrative and historic county of Norfolk, England, consisting of shallow lakes formed by the broadening of the Rivers Bure and Yare, which connect many of the waterways.
